Verdict: Ford 2000 vs Ford 333

The Ford 2000 and the Ford 333 are both industrial tractors — here is how they stack up on the figures that matter. Ford 2000 leads on rated power with 48 hp against 47 hp. Ford 2000 is the lighter machine (1,282 kg vs 2,347 kg), which helps on soft ground and transport, while the heavier model carries more ballast for traction-limited draft work. Ford 333 is the newer design (1975 vs 1960). In short: choose the Ford 2000 for outright pulling power, or the Ford 333 if a tighter budget and lighter footprint matter more.
